What type of rental buildings are in Hartford, IN?
In Hartford 26% of the housing is rented out compared to 74% of homes are owned, according to the most recent Census Bureau estimates. 0.5% of Hartford’s apartments are found in large buildings of 50 units or more, 55% are located in smaller apartment complexes with less than 50 units, and 34% are single-family rentals.
